Default Prepping Vegetable Maki?



How long can you make cucumber or avocado maki in advance? Just
straight vegetables, no fish involved.

The biggest problem is the nori will get soggy from the moisture
from its ingredients. You cut make the rice and keep it warm for
several hours in advance, and you can cut the veggies in adavance.
I wouldn't roll them into makis until less than one hour before
serving. The rice will dry out, the nori get soggy.
